On which atomic property proposed by Henry Moseley is the current periodic table of the elements based?(1 point)
Responses

electric charge

atomic weight

atomic number

nucleus size
1 year ago

Answers

GPT-4 Turbo
The current periodic table of the elements is based on atomic number, which corresponds to the number of protons in the nucleus of an atom. This was proposed by Henry Moseley in 1913.
